Step-by-step explanation:
The degrees of a triangle add up to 180.
Angle C is already 90 degrees therefore angle A + angle B = 90 degrees.
Angle A is equal to sinA=1/2.
sinA=1/2 is equal to 30 degrees if you press 2nd, sin (1/2) into the calculator. You may also know this if you have memorized the values of trig.
90-30=60.
That leaves you with 60 degrees for angle B.
